One of the problems is that the firmware the phones get shipped with is too buggy to be useful, some of the major bugs (that affected me) for a ZTE Open C as released with Firefox OS 1.3: https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1030626 https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1031573 https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1012222 And then there is https://www.mozilla.org/en-GB/security/advisories/mfsa2014-73/ which is marked as critical. So as a consumer the only options are either to use an unofficial firmware (as I don't have any hope of ZTE ever releasing an update for that phone) or to claim the money back as the device is not fit for purpose.
